Title Note

Pink Martini: China Forbes, Pepe Raphael (vocals); Dan Faehnle (guitar); Aaron Meyer (violin); David Eby (cello); Maureen Love (harp); Gavin Bondy (trumpet); Robert Taylor (trombone); Thomas M. Lauderdale (piano); Doug Smith (vibraphone, percussion); John Wager (bass); Richard Rothfus (bongos, drums, percussion); Brian Davis (congas, timbales, percussion); Derek Rieth (percussion)

Recorded at Stiles Recording Studio, Portland, Oregon, from December 1996 to April 1997.

The first album by Portland, Oregon's tongue in cheek lounge pop orchestra Pink Martini, SYMPATHIQUE, was originally released in 1997 on the band's own Heinz label. Although the album contains two originals by singer China Forbes and pianist Thomas Lauderdale, the title track and "Lullaby," the bulk of the album's 12 songs consists of new arrangements of loungy favorites like "Never On Sunday," "Que Sera Sera," "Brazil," and "Song of the Black Lizard," taken from the soundtrack of a Japanese cult film. Unlike contemporaries such as Combustible Edison, Pink Martini had the musical chops and heartfelt love of the style to keep the album from descending into snarky kitsch. In 2009, Heinz Records released the first ever vinyl edition of the album.
